Vera M. "Grandma Buddy" Howard was born April 25, 1934, in Goodman, Missouri, one of seven children to Wesley and Martha (Boman) Charlton. She entered into rest on March 19, 2023, at McDonald County Living Center in Anderson, at the age of 88. Vera was a lifelong area resident and graduated from Goodman High School. She worked in the Couples Department of Eagle Picher for many years and then owned and operated a kennel with her husband, Francis. Vera enjoyed crocheting, gardening, fishing and watching Cardinal's baseball. She deeply loved her family, especially her grandchildren, and spending time with them. She was a member of Faith Assembly of God Church in Joplin. On September 1, 1951, in Goodman, Missouri, Vera and Francis E. Howard were united in marriage and he preceded her in death on July 24, 2020. She is survived by five children, Marcy Crawmer and husband, Jim of Neosho, Rita Kittell of Bowling Green, Kentucky, Leonard Howard and wife, Carol of Miami, Oklahoma, Joyce Davis and husband, Steve of Goodman and Cheryl Peters and husband, Dan of Neosho; one sister, Joyce Hall of Eufaula, Oklahoma, one brother, Gerald Charlton of Glenside, Pennsylvania; fourteen grandchildren, thirty-three great grandchildren and seven great-great grandchildren. In addition to her husband and parents, she is preceded in death by a granddaughter, Heather Dawn Crawmer; three brothers, Ernest, Eldon and John W. Charlton and a sister, Jeannean Charlton Walker.
